Meaning
Endoscopy guidewires are thin, flexible wires made from materials such as stainless steel or nitinol. These wires are designed to be maneuverable and can be easily navigated through the body’s natural passages, such as the digestive or urinary tract. The guidewire acts as a pathway for the endoscope, enabling physicians to accurately guide and position the instrument within the body.

Category-wise Insights
- Stainless Steel Guidewires: Stainless steel guidewires are widely used in endoscopy procedures. They offer good maneuverability, flexibility, and pushability, making them suitable for a variety of applications.
- Nitinol Guidewires: Nitinol guidewires are gaining popularity due to their shape memory properties. These guidewires can return to their original shape even after being bent or twisted, allowing for precise navigation within the body.
- Hydrophilic Coated Guidewires: Hydrophilic coated guidewires have a lubricious surface that facilitates smooth insertion and reduces friction during the procedure. These guidewires are particularly useful in navigating tortuous anatomical structures.
- Gastroenterology Applications: Guidewires used in gastroenterology applications enable the diagnosis and treatment of conditions such as gastrointestinal cancers, strictures, and bleeding. They aid in the precise positioning of endoscopes for accurate visualization and intervention.
- Urology Applications: Guidewires used in urology procedures help in the diagnosis and treatment of conditions such as kidney stones, ureteral strictures, and urinary tract infections. They assist in navigating the urinary tract and accessing targeted areas for intervention.
- Pulmonology and Cardiology Applications: Guidewires are also utilized in pulmonology and cardiology procedures, enabling the diagnosis and treatment of conditions such as lung tumors, cardiac stenosis, and coronary artery diseases. They aid in accessing and navigating the airways and blood vessels for interventions.
